Registration-based Construction of a Whole-body Human Phantom Library for Anthropometric Modeling
Abstract:
Various computational human phantoms have been proposed in the past decades, but few of them include delicate anthropometric variations. In this study, we build a whole-body phantom library including 145 anthropometric parameters. This library is constructed by registration-based pipeline, which transfers a standard whole-body anatomy template to an anthropometry-adjustable body shape library (MakeHuman™). Therefore, internal anatomical structures are created for body shapes of different anthropometric parameters. Based on the constructed library, we can generate individualized whole-body phantoms according to given arbitrary anthropometric parameters. Moreover, the proposed phantom library can also be converted to voxel-based and tetrahedron-based model for further personalized simulation. We hope this phantom library will serve as a computational tool in research community.
